WebFeb 1, 2024 · Dublin. Dublin, the capital city of the Republic of Ireland, is the centre of all business, cultural and political affairs in the country. With a population of 1.4 million, it is small by global standards, but its cultural and social reputation is known the world over. WebDublin is the capital and largest city in Ireland. As of 2016, Dublin's population is554,554 people in its capital. Its 2024 metropolitan population is 1.42 million, and the Greater Dublin area has 1.9 million people. Dublin is the country's economic center, being the 10th-richest city by personal income and the fourth-richest by purchasing power.

Web2 days ago · Dublin city centre will see heightened security and traffic disruption on Thursday as US president Joe Biden takes part in four separate engagements in the … WebCounty Dublin was the first county in Ireland to be shired in the 1190s, and the city became the capital of the English Lordship of Ireland. Dublin was peopled extensively with settlers from England and Wales, and the rural area around the city, as far north as Drogheda, also saw extensive English settlement.
